Music is used like a healing employ for hundreds of years.[142] Apollo is The traditional Greek god of music and of medicine and his son Aesculapius was said to remedy conditions in the intellect by utilizing song and music. By 5000 BC, music was used for healing by Egyptian priest-physicians.[122] Plato said that music afflicted the emotions and could impact the character of somebody. Aristotle taught that music has an effect on the soul and described music as a drive that purified the thoughts. Aulus Cornelius Celsus advocated the sound of cymbals and managing drinking water for that treatment of mental disorders. Music as therapy was practiced during the Bible when David played the harp to rid King Saul of a foul spirit (1 Sam sixteen:23).[143][website page required] As early as four hundred B.C., Hippocrates performed music for mental patients.

Musical healing techniques continued through the center Ages. Via the 1800s, experiences of music therapy techniques and uses for groups in institutions began to arise in western medicine. nineteenth century psychiatrists Benjamin Rush, Edwin Atlee, and Samuel Matthews wrote about music therapy being a dietary supplement to psychiatry.

Start out by searching for a board-Licensed music therapist. In the U.S., the Activities For Music Therapy certification system requires therapists to complete an undergraduate or master’s degree in music therapy at an authorized establishment, together with clinical training as well as a supervised internship.
There is tentative evidence that music interventions led by a qualified music therapist can have favourable effects on psychological and Bodily results in adults with cancer. The effectiveness of music therapy for children with cancer just isn't identified.[39]
